New WMD claims in Iraq.
Now they're talking about WMD's being in the hands of terrorists in Iraq.

On CBS news website, there’s a video report available entitled, “7 GIs Killed, Hostage Demands”. But when you click on the link, nowhere in the video are the 7 killed GIs mentioned. What is mentioned is a new dimension to the war in Iraq. The news announcer says that Iraqi security officials suspect terrorists like Abu Musabal-Zarqawi are looking for weapons with a “wider reach”. Iraqi National Security Advisor, Muwaffaq Al-Rubaie is quoted as saying, “What could be bigger and larger psychological impact than using a weapon of mass destruction?”



Here we go again. It seems that we’re facing the WMD card again in Iraq, yet the new twist this time is that they’re in the hands of terrorists. And, once again, there is NO evidence whatsoever to support such claims. I find it very suspicious that CBS would use as bait the title, “7 GIs killed”, and have no mention of them in their report, but instead report on seemingly bogus WMD claims.
